摘要
The major objective of paper is to contribute to solve of problems of machining (technological operation - turning) of wood plastic composite (material with natural reinforcement and matrix from plastic). During turning with tools with big nose radius and positive geometry, the spindle speed n (from 450 min(-1) to 1400 min-1) and feed rate f (from 0.1 to 0.61 mm) were changed. Output from measured data (Rvk, Rk, Rpk, Mr1 and Mr2 - probability descriptors) is Abbott-Firestone curve.
